Partner refuses to start

I'm having a nightmare with my 2023 Peugeot Partner (gasoline engine). I've done 185013 km and now it just refuses to start! The engine turns over, but it won't actually fire up. I'm getting a 'Engine control malfunction' warning. I've checked the obvious things like fuel and fuses, but no luck. Could it be some kind of ECU failure? Any ideas?

piaghost5

I had exactly the same issue with my Partner a while back. 'Engine control malfunction' message, wouldn't start. Have you checked your battery cable connections? Are they clean and tight?

williamhimmel73 (Author)

Battery connections, huh? I hadn't thought of that! They looked okay at first glance, but I'll double-check them properly tomorrow. What exactly was wrong with yours? Was it just loose, or corroded, or what?

piaghost5

Yeah, mine looked okay too, but there was some hidden corrosion. Gave them a good clean and tightened them up, and she fired right up. Though, honestly, if that doesn't fix it, I'd take it to a workshop. ECU issues can be a real pain to diagnose yourself.

williamhimmel73 (Author)

You were spot on! I cleaned the battery cable connections, and it started immediately. Turns out they weren't as good as I thought. Cost me 155€ at the workshop. Thanks so much for the advice!
